The Exorcist: Martyrs
According to World of Reel, Mike Flanagan’s Exorcist movie is titled The Exorcist: Martyrs and stars Scarlett Johansson as a new detective who takes on a case involving “inconceivable darkness.”

Assassin’s Creed
Deadline reports Lola Pettigrew will star alongside Toby Wallace in the live-action Assassin’s Creed TV series at Netflix. Details on her character are not available at this time.
Pushing Daisies
In addition to a fourth season of Hannibal, Bryan Fuller revealed to The Mary Sue he has a “pitch” for a third season of Pushing Daisies and “the entire cast wants to come back.”
We have a season three pitch, and the entire cast wants to come back, and we’re hoping we get to return to them. We just have to find somebody who wants to make it.
Star Trek: Starfleet Academy
During his recent appearance at CCXP in Brazil, Paul Giamatti discussed the motivations of his half-Klingon, half-Tellarite character, Nus Braka.
Well, he’s a pirate, kind of. He’s a little bit of a pirate. He’s a kind of he’s got his finger in every kind of criminal activity. He’s a smuggler. He’s a trafficker, of all kinds. And he leads a group called the Vanari Ral, who are pirates, basically. So he’s been all over the galaxy. And he’s a lowlife. And he’s a nobody who thinks he’s a somebody. And he likes to clown around and play the fool and stuff. But he’s a very dangerous psychopath underneath it all. Yeah, he’s very mean to the kids. I think he envies the kids. I think he wishes he had people supporting him and being nice to him the way everybody is to these kids. So I think he hates and envies these kids.
